Yes the second transplant went very well and had around 1700 grafts in the crown area. So a total of 3700 grafts (1700 in the front and 2000 in the crown). I am happy with the results so far but still thin. I think another 4000 would restore my hair very well but my family is not allowing me for any more surgery. Guys, I will post my pictures in another 1 - 2 days, you have to wait for it. Recently started using nanogen only for crown and amazing results and just now ordered dermmatch. I would also like to comment that anyone with norwood 5A would need 7000 - 8000 grafts to get a normal and good look. Even if I go in for another 4000 grafts, I would go for FUE and that is going to cost Rs.75 ($1.5) compared to Rs.25 for FUHT. But I also noticed one thing that can improve your hair growth.
